Soucek insists West Ham squad deep enough to handle top four battle

Tomas Soucek insists West Ham's squad is deep enough to handle their top four battle.

Declan Rice, Michail Antonio and Angelo Ogbonna were already missing for Sunday's win over Leicester, before Aaron Cresswell was forced off with a hamstring injury and captain Mark Noble left the pitch with a knock to his elbow.

"Yes many injuries, but it is football," he told the London Evening Standard. "We've lost Declan, Angelo and we don't know how many injuries from yesterday.

"We don't have [Andriy] Yarmolenko or [Manuel] Lanzini but I hope that they will be ready soon.

"It is great that we don't only have 10 or 11 players. We have a great team and a great spirit in the changing room, we have more than 20 great footballers so it is very good that we don't only play with these 10 players. We can be ready with 20 or more players."
